Stefanie Fair Returns to Music with "Better Version of Me": Watch the Video Now

The #TGTM mama just debuted her new visual for her empowering ballad. 

By Jocelyn Vena
Stefanie Fair: "Better Version of Me"

She's back! After sharing her fear of returning to the stage earlier this season on There Goes the Motherhood, Stefanie Fair marks her return to the music scene with the release of her empowering ballad, "Better Version of Me." The track, produced by her husband Ron Fair, reflects on the former Wild Orchid singer's struggles to find her singing voice, and the video shows Stefanie's dual sides as a singer/performer and mom to her four kids. In the end, the music video, directed by Patrick Tracy (Little Big Town, Kacey Musgraves, Halsey), is triumphant as it tracks Stefanie's return to pop music.

"Better Version of Me" was co-written with songwriter Steve Diamond (Britney Spears, Reba McEntire, Backstreet Boys), and Stefanie previously explained the strong message behind the tune. “Songwriting to me is almost like a therapy, if I would only take my own advice, but I wrote the song because every day I wake up and I really do try to be a better version of me,” she says. “I don’t have any expectations [on where my singing career will go], I’m really trying to not put that pressure I used to put on myself back in the day.”
